Abstract
The directional blasting method of trapezoid blasting cut was applied to dismantle a 94 m high reinforced concrete chimney in Dalian,and got success.According to the structure of the chimney and blasting environment,reasonable parameters of blasting cut were chosen.Tentative blasting,beforehand demolition and safety protection were made to ensure the chimney collapse successfully,and flying rock and vibration are well controlled.It gets good blasting effect and provides reference to similar blasting demolition engineering.
